Podcast
Questions and Answers
What is a major goal of this course regarding design?
What is a major goal of this course regarding design?
Which role of the architect involves analyzing past workloads?
Which role of the architect involves analyzing past workloads?
What does the 'Look Forward' role of an architect encourage?
What does the 'Look Forward' role of an architect encourage?
In the context of a computer architect, what does 'Look Down' refer to?
In the context of a computer architect, what does 'Look Down' refer to?
Signup and view all the answers
Which of the following is NOT a focus area for this course?
Which of the following is NOT a focus area for this course?
Signup and view all the answers
Study Notes
Course Goals
- Understand the principles and precedents of computer architecture
- Evaluate the tradeoffs of different designs and concepts
- Develop principled designs
- Create novel designs
- Focus on principles, precedent, and their implementation in new designs
Role of the Architect
- Analyze historical designs and architectures to understand tradeoffs and workloads
- Understand the history of computer architecture to learn from successes and failures
- Create new designs and ideas, pushing the boundaries of computer architecture
- Explore new design choices and evaluate their effectiveness
- Identify and understand important problems in computer architecture
- Develop architectures and ideas to solve problems
- Understand the capabilities of underlying technologies
- Predict and adapt to the future of technology, designing for many years ahead
- Enable future technology through design and innovation
Studying That Suits You
Use AI to generate personalized quizzes and flashcards to suit your learning preferences.
Description
Explore the fundamental principles and historical precedents of computer architecture in this quiz. Evaluate tradeoffs of various designs and understand their implications on technology's future. Test your knowledge on creating novel and principled architectural designs.